Introduction
Poker is an extensively popular card online game that integrates ability, method, and a little bit of possibility. With many variants like texas holdem, Omaha, and Seven-Card Stud, poker provides people a thrilling and competitive gaming knowledge. To achieve poker, people want to develop efficient strategies that optimize their decision making abilities, and in turn, boost their likelihood of winning. This report explores some key poker strategies, focusing the necessity of understanding the game, reading opponents, handling money, and strategic decision-making.

Understanding the Game
One of the fundamental aspects of poker method is having an extensive comprehension of the game as well as its guidelines. Players needs to be acquainted with hand ranks, gambling frameworks, and possible results. By learning the overall game's fundamentals, players can make informed decisions and strategize efficiently, analyzing the chances and possible incentives.

Reading Opponents
An essential aspect of poker method is the ability to read opponents and decipher their playing designs and actions. This skill enables players to achieve insight into their particular opponents' fingers, allowing them to modify unique techniques properly. Observing body language, gambling patterns, and spoken cues are crucial aspects of properly reading opponents in poker.

Handling Bankroll
Effective bankroll administration is vital to sustained success in poker. People must set clear limits on the investing, only gambling with cash they can manage to lose. It is wise to split Poker Real Money funds from individual funds and also to keep a stringent budget. By managing their money carefully, players can mitigate risks while making knowledgeable choices without falling in to the traps of careless wagering.

Strategic Decision-Making
Strategic decision-making has reached the core of poker techniques. Players should evaluate numerous aspects, like the energy of their own hand, table dynamics, place, additionally the behavior of opponents. For instance, adopting an aggressive method may be beneficial whenever keeping powerful cards, as it can certainly intimidate opponents and force all of them to fold. Conversely, a more conventional strategy can be proper when dealt weaker arms, restricting potential losings. In the end, the ability to adjust and work out strategic decisions predicated on these facets is a must for success.

Bluffing and Deception
A well-executed bluff may be a strong device in poker method, permitting players to win pots with weaker hands. Bluffing involves deceiving opponents giving them false impressions for the player's hand power or objectives. However, bluffing should always be approached cautiously and selectively, as exorbitant bluffing can diminish its effectiveness and trigger economic losings.

Recognizing and Exploiting Patterns
Comprehending patterns in opponents' behavior and wagering can provide important insights within their strategies. Competent players can exploit these habits by modifying their particular techniques accordingly. If a new player continuously raises pre-flop but often folds following the flop, other players can exploit this predictability by modifying their very own ways of take advantage of the circumstance. Recognizing and exploiting these types of habits can provide players a significant edge in the poker dining table.

Summary
Establishing efficient poker methods is a continuing procedure that needs a combination of skill, knowledge, and adaptability. By understanding the game, reading opponents, handling money, and making strategic choices, players can enhance their chances of success. Additionally, learning the skill of bluffing and exploiting patterns adds another level of complexity to a single's poker strategy. In the end, an intelligent and adaptable strategy, coupled with continuous understanding and knowledge, can ensure a person's long-term profitability and satisfaction associated with game.
